Trinidad and Tobago - Re-Export of Textile Yarn and Strip, Impregnated, Coated, Covered or Sheathed with Rubber or Plastics
Since 2010, Trinidad and Tobago Re-Export of Textile Yarn and Strip, Impregnated, Coated, Covered or Sheathed with Rubber or Plastics was up 54.3% year on year. In 2015, the country was ranked number 8 comparing other countries in Re-Export of Textile Yarn and Strip, Impregnated, Coated, Covered or Sheathed with Rubber or Plastics with $6,533. Trinidad and Tobago is overtaken by Namibia, which was ranked number 7 at $16,963.51 and is followed by Bahrain at $5,011.18. United Arab Emirates ranked the highest with $1,026,675.02 in 2019, a decrease of 5.9% compared to 2018. United States, Oman and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Italy recorded the best 5 years average growth at +110.9% per year, while Namibia recorded the worst performance at -55.1% per year.
